If you are pregnant when you get your Depo shot are you likely to miscarry?

Answer:
No. Depo-Provera will not harm or end an existing pregnancy, and will not increase the risk of miscarriage. (The risk of miscarriage is high overall; 15% of confirmed pregnancies end in miscarriage [Contraceptive Technology, 18th ed]) . The biggest danger in getting the Depo Provera injection while already pregnant is delayed diagnosis of pregnancy. If you are at risk of pregnancy when you get your injection, take a pregnancy test no sooner than ten days after unprotected sex. If you are pregnant, you can still continue or terminate the pregnancy.
